How much do remote freelance sports writer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ote freelance sports writer in the United States is $23.27,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.43 and $26.20 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ote freelance sports writer?

A Remote Freelance Sports Writer is a professional who creates sports-related content, such as articles, news stories, or analysis, while working independently and outside of a traditional office setting. These writers typically work on a contract basis for various clients, including sports websites, magazines, or news outlets. Their responsibilities may include researching sports events, interviewing athletes or coaches, and meeting editorial deadlines. This role offers flexibility in terms of location and schedule, making it ideal for those who want to combine a passion for sports with writing skills.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a remote freelance sports writer?

To thrive as a Remote Freelance Sports Writer, you need strong writing skills, a deep understanding of sports, and experience with journalism or content creation, often supported by a relevant degree or portfolio.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S), SEO tools, and digital publishing platforms is typically required. Exceptional time management, adaptability, and the ability to communicate clearly with editors and sources are standout soft skills. These abilities ensure engaging, accurate content is delivered consistently and on deadline in a competitive digital media landscape.

What are common challenges faced by remote freelance sports writers and how can they be overcome?

Remote freelance sports writers often face challenges such as tight deadlines, staying updated with real-time sports events, and maintaining consistent communication with editors and clients. To overcome these, it's important to develop strong time management skills, use digital tools for real-time updates, and establish clear communication channels. Additionally, building a network with other writers and editors can provide support and help in sourcing stories or interviews.

What is the difference between Remote Freelance Sports Writer vs Remote Sports Journalist?

AspectRemote Freelance Sports WriterRemote Sports Journalist
CredentialsWriting experience, sports knowledgeJournalism degree, reporting skills
Work EnvironmentFreelance, independentFreelance or staff, media outlets
Employer/IndustrySports blogs, magazines, websitesNews outlets, broadcasters
Search/Comparison IntentWriting, sports content creationReporting, news coverage

Remote Freelance Sports Writers focus on creating sports-related content independently, often for blogs or magazines, while Remote Sports Journalists typically report news and cover sports events for media outlets. Both roles require sports knowledge, but journalists usually need reporting skills and journalism credentials. The main difference lies in their focus: content creation versus news reporting.
